You have a class C subnet. You would like divide it up into 12 more subnets by "subnetting". However you also have to have at least 13 hosts per subnet. Can you do it ?
Answer Posted / indu
Yes.
Referring: to the formulas in the "SUBNETTING FORMULAS" section.
M = 4 (since max number of subnets would be 6 if M = 3)
N = 8-M = 4
Max hosts per subnet = 2^4 -2 = 14
